weDevs Subscribe2 Plugin Broken Access Control Vulnerability

Vulnerability

A broken access control vulnerability has been identified in the weDevs Subscribe2 WordPress plugin, affecting versions through 10.44. This vulnerability arises from missing authorization checks, which could allow an unprivileged user to perform actions reserved for higher privileges.

Impact

Exploitation of this vulnerability could enable an unprivileged user to execute actions that require higher privileges, potentially leading to unauthorized changes or access within the application.

Remediation

Users of the Subscribe2 WordPress plugin should update to version 10.45 or later to address this vulnerability. Patchstack users can enable auto-update for vulnerable plugins.
